Then you can go back and test your key words. But start with GPS-centric words like: dallas real estate, miami real estate, or cincinnati homes for sale... you get the idea. Learning how to create great, rich key words that will get you ranked is sort of hard to guess. WordTracker and now WordStream will show you what the top key words are.
I typed in the words: dallas real estate and I got the following results:

As you can see, the results in order are pretty interesting. It reveals the NEXT highest search term is: dallas real estate agent, then dallas real estate search, etc.
Naturally the firm WordStream is going to have paid tools you can use, but for 90% of us who just don't have a clue how to research keywords and get them into your website, this is a wonderful tool that can help you eliminate the guesswork.
